IndiQube Spaces IPO: All You Need to Know
IndiQube Spaces, a provider of managed and co-working office spaces, launched its Initial Public Offering (IPO) on July 22, 2025. The IPO has drawn attention due to its presence in the high-growth real estate and workspace solutions sector. The offering is available for subscription until July 24, and it is priced at ₹85 per share.
IPO Details and Subscription Window
Price Band: Fixed at ₹85 per share
Issue Size: ₹160 crore (Fresh issue + OFS)
IPO Open Date: July 22, 2025
IPO Close Date: July 24, 2025
Lot Size: 1,600 shares
GMP (Grey Market Premium): ₹10 as of Day 1
The proceeds from the IPO will primarily be used for expansion, debt repayment, and infrastructure enhancement.
Company Profile: What Does IndiQube Do?
IndiQube Spaces operates in India’s fast-growing co-working and flexible office space segment. With a strong presence in metro cities like Bengaluru, Pune, and Hyderabad, it offers a blend of private offices, shared workspaces, and enterprise solutions to startups and corporates alike.
The shift in post-COVID work preferences and increased demand for scalable workspace solutions have added to IndiQube’s appeal.
Investor Sentiment: GMP and Subscription Buzz
While the ₹10 GMP suggests a lukewarm but positive response, the company’s asset-light model and tech-driven space management strategy have attracted retail and HNI investors. However, the margin pressure and high competition in the real estate sector raise caution flags.
Should You Invest?
Analysts are divided. Supporters point to the growing demand for co-working spaces and IndiQube’s scalable model. Skeptics cite operational losses and real estate sector volatility. If you’re a high-risk investor looking for long-term potential in the workspace sector, IndiQube Spaces might be worth considering.
Key Risks to Consider
High competition from established co-working brands
Real estate market fluctuations
Consistent losses in previous fiscal years
Dependency on Tier-1 city operations
